Updated to Linux kernel 6.8.8-zen - safeeyes not starting

Open ArchieLinux opened this issue 3 months ago • 0 comments

This is an installation issue, not a program bug per se. But this seems to be the place to report the issue:

I noticed that the safeeyes icon is not appearing after today's regular update to Arch/kernel 6.8.8-zen1-1-zen and a reboot. My system shows it is installed but not functional.

So I uninstalled it (yay -Rc safeeyes) and then explicitly rebuilt the package clean (i.e., invoking yay -S safeeyes to commence a clean install).

Still no luck. Can't seem to get safeeyes to start up anymore. :shrug:

==> Cleaning up... [sudo] password for {xxx}: error: invalid option '-s'

Everything seems to work perfectly until this simple error message (above) which is the final line in the terminal.

Any thoughts as to why would be appreciated?
